Regular Season Round 2: Le Portel - Strasbourg 82-79
Date: September 26, 2018
There was a minor upset when SIG Strasbourg (1-1) was edged on the road by Le Portel (1-1) 82-79 on Wednesday. Le Portel looked well-organized offensively handing out 23 assists. SIG Strasbourg was plagued by 24 personal fouls down the stretch. The best player for the winners was naturalized Burkinabe Jean-Victor Traore (203-85) who had a double-double by scoring 12 points and 11 rebounds. American swingman Anthony Hilliard (195-86, college: Elizabeth City) chipped in 14 points and 7 assists. American forward Mardy Collins (196-84, college: Temple) produced 12 points, 9 rebounds and 7 assists and Senegalese center Youssoupha Fall (221-95) added 11 points, 8 rebounds and 4 assists respectively for the guests. Five Le Portel and four SIG Strasbourg players scored in double figures. SIG Strasbourg's coach gave the chance to play for ten players, but that didn't help to avoid defeat in this game. Le Portel will face Limoges CSP Elite (#9) at home in the next round. SIG Strasbourg will play against Pau-Lacq-Orthez (#18) and hope to win that game.
